Problem

The existing air deflector drive means in indoor air-conditioning units suffer from poor stability of the connecting rod during telescoping movement, leading to unstable operation of the air deflector.

Innovation Solution

The air deflector drive means incorporates a limiting structure within the drive case, comprising pillars and rolling members with limiting grooves, and chute guide rails to restrict the connecting rod's displacement in all directions, ensuring it moves along a preset trajectory, thereby stabilizing its operation.

Disclosed is an air deflector drive means, comprising a drive case and connecting rod (3). One side of the drive case is provided with a protruding opening (11), the connecting rod (3) is slidably provided in the drive case, and a tip (31) of the connecting rod (3) is limited in the direction perpendicular to the direction of movement of the connecting rod by means of the limiting structure. Furthermore, also disclosed is an indoor air conditioning unit using the drive means.
